Bienvenue chez Vocella’s Bistro La famille Vocella est originaire de Terelle, une charmante ville nichée dans les montagnes italiennes. La gastronomie occupe une place essentielle dans la vie familiale italienne, et pour Lisa Vocella, chef et propriétaire, cela n’a jamais fait exception. Dès son plus jeune âge, elle a développé une passion pour l’art culinaire en cuisinant le week-end avec sa Nonna et en participant aux activités familiales dans le secteur de l’alimentation. Après avoir obtenu avec mention son diplôme en cuisine, Lisa est rentrée chez elle pour réaliser son rêve : ouvrir un restaurant. Vocella’s a ouvert ses portes le 17 juillet 2018, et depuis, Lisa consacre tout son savoir-faire à vous offrir le meilleur de la cuisine italienne. Notre sélection de vins provient de petits producteurs méconnus, pour garantir une authenticité totale à votre repas. Toute notre viande et nos poissons sont issus de producteurs locaux et découpés sur place, tandis que nos charcuteries proviennent directement de la région natale de Vocella, parce qu’en la matière, les Italiens savent parfaitement faire. Chaque plat est préparé à la commande, du début à la fin. Nous ne croyons pas à la restauration rapide, mais à une cuisine fraîche servie aussi vite que possible. Cette approche reflète l’engagement de notre équipe à vous offrir une expérience authentique au cœur de Longford Town. Lisa Vocella trouve une immense joie à allier ses deux passions, la famille et la cuisine, et toute l’équipe de Vocella’s se mobilise pour que vous partagiez ce même plaisir.
